dogybab
what is the purpose in fortifying your skills, especially magic skills? in my experience when magic skills are boosted by spells, enchantments, or even being a vampire, they don't seem to benefit you in any way other than being able to buy or create spells. Also you don't get any skill perks either in your other skills. what gives?
HyPN0
You fortify your Destruction,your Destruction spells are cheaper to cast.
You fortify your Restoration,the cheaper you heal.
You fortify your Armor,and your armor rating grows.
You fortify your Acrobatics the higher you jump.
And many other examples.
Offcourse,those enchantments are useless if your skill is already at 100.

The Ascendant
Unfortunately you can't cast spells higher than your mastery level if the vampire thing (or any enchantment) puts it up. I've tried and was disappointed because I now have a completely useless (until I reach level 50 illusion) invisibility spell.
